  4. Taken together, eating disorders affect up to 5% of the population, most often develop in adolescence and young adulthood. Several, especially anorexia nervosa and bulimia nervosa are more common in women, but they can all occur at any age and affect any gender.

  5. 22 Απρ 2021 · Anorexia and bulimia are the most common eating disorders. Anorexia involves restricting food, a fear of gaining weight and distorted body image. Bulimia involves bingeing with large amounts of food and then purging by vomiting, laxative use, fasting or compulsive exercising.
